Jonathan Gresham has said that a WWE decision to break with traditional heel/face dynamics “f***ed up everything.”

In 1997, to usher in the Attitude Era, Vince McMahon spoke directly to the audience, saying:

“We also believe you are tired of the simplistic theory of good guys vs bad guys.”

In a recent interview with WrestlePurists, Gresham spoke about how wrestling has changed:

“Wrestling has evolved so much – I think it was something WWE said where it’s like people aren’t always good and aren’t always bad. That f—ed up everything. Once that happened, things changed.

“That [form of storytelling] can be done with a couple of people, but there need to be people that are bad and good. If you watch any successful Disney movie, there’s always a villain and a good guy. Now, most wrestling is face vs. face, and everything is pop, pop, pop.”

Gresham lost the Ring of Honor World Championship to Claudio Castagnoli at the recent Death Before Dishonor pay-per-view event, and has reportedly asked for his release by Tony Khan.
